3. Enable Two‑Factor Authentication and Strong Passwords
Security starts with you. Activate two‑factor authentication (2FA) on the platform and on any linked banking apps. A simple text code or authentication app adds a second barrier that thieves struggle to bypass.
Create a password that mixes upper‑case, lower‑case, numbers, and symbols. Avoid obvious words like “password” or “123456.” Change it at least every six months.
Rhetorical question: What would happen if a hacker obtained just your username and password? Without 2FA, they could drain your bankroll in minutes.
The site’s infrastructure includes continuous monitoring for suspicious log‑ins. If an unusual IP address tries to access your account, you’ll receive an instant alert, giving you time to lock the account before any loss occurs.
Remember, a strong password plus 2FA works like a double‑locked safe – it protects both your funds and personal data.

5. Keep Your Device and Connection Secure – Final Recommendations
Your computer or phone is the front line of defense. Keep the operating system, browser, and any casino apps up to date. Install a reputable antivirus program and avoid public Wi‑Fi when making transactions.
Bullet list – Quick security checklist:
– ✔ Update OS and apps regularly
– ✔ Use a trusted VPN on public networks
– ✔ Enable 2FA on all accounts
– ✔ Verify the site’s URL ends with uk-this-is-vegas.com
– ✔ Review the SSL certificate (look for the padlock icon)
